Present Tense Conjugation

Sonreír is the infinitive, and its conjugated forms include sonrío, sonríes, sonríe, sonreímos, sonreís, and sonríen.

Gerund and Participle Uses

Sonriendo functions as a gerund in progressive tenses, while sonreído serves as a past participle in perfect compound structures.
